Research the Regulations and Licenses Required for Your Home-Based Business
Before you launch your business, it’s important to research the local and state regulations and determine what licenses are necessary. Depending on where you live, there may be specific rules and regulations that you need to follow in order to legally operate a business from your home. Additionally, you may need to apply for a business license and/or register with your local or state government. It’s important to make sure you have all the proper paperwork in order before you start taking clients.

Choose the Products and Supplies You Will Offer
Next, you’ll need to select the products and supplies you will offer. Research the various types of press on nails available and decide which ones you want to offer your customers. Once you’ve chosen the products you want to sell, it’s time to find reliable suppliers for those products. Make sure you shop around for the best prices and quality.

Set Up a Safe and Sanitary Work Environment
It’s also important to set up a safe and sanitary work environment. Make sure you establish safety protocols and invest in sanitation supplies such as disinfectant wipes and hand sanitizer. You should also provide disposable gloves and face masks for both you and your clients.
